Output ec89e5796a4def760f7417172380682a0894e74c906fb27fe8d6bf22eba471e4:0

value
1898173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ec272443b7c873b9cd2853412209aeb08603bd25 OP_EQUAL
address
3PDgHRek1WuaK3A8iYp3trFJegc5SwyADf
transaction
ec89e5796a4def760f7417172380682a0894e74c906fb27fe8d6bf22eba471e4
spent
true